The Human (Al-Insan)
In the Name of God, the Merciful, the Compassionate
Has there come on man a while of time when he was a thing unremembered? 1 We have created the human from a (sperm) drop, a mixture, testing him; We made him to hear and see. 2 Lo! We have shown him the way, whether he be grateful or disbelieving. 3 Surely We have prepared for the unbelievers chains, fetters, and a Blaze. 4 Verily, the Abrar (pious, who fear Allah and avoid evil), shall drink a cup (of wine) mixed with water from a spring in Paradise called Kafur. 5 a source [of bliss] whereof God's servants shall drink, seeing it flow in a flow abundant. 6 They fulfil their vows, and fear a day whose evil is upon the wing; 7 And feed with food the needy wretch, the orphan and the prisoner, for love of Him, 8 (Saying): "We feed you seeking Allah's Countenance only. We wish for no reward, nor thanks from you. 9 We are afraid of our Lord and the bitterly distressful day". 10 So God will protect them from the evil of that day, and grant them happiness and joy, 11 and will reward them for their steadfastness with Paradise and robes of silk. 12 In that [garden] they will on couches recline, and will know therein neither [burning] sun nor cold severe, 13 The shades of the garden will be closely spread over them and it will be easy for them to reach the fruits. 14 And amongst them will be passed round vessels of silver and goblets of crystal,- 15 Glass made from silver, which the servers have filled up to the measure. 16 and they will be given a cup to drink flavoured with ginger, 17 A spring there, called Salsabil. 18 ۞ And boys of everlasting youth will go about attending them. Looking at them you would think that they were pearls dispersed. 19 when thou seest them then thou seest bliss and a great kingdom. 20 Upon them will be green Garments of fine silk and heavy brocade, and they will be adorned with Bracelets of silver; and their Lord will give to them to drink of a Wine Pure and Holy. 21 Behold, this is a recompense for you, and your striving is thanked.' 22
